XXIX World Law Congress Kicks Off in Santo Domingo

Last Sunday in Santo Domingo, the inauguration of the XXIX World Congress of Law took place. This event aims to address the importance of defending and protecting the rule of law, as well as the fundamental role played by new generations in its strengthening and in the preservation of democracy.

The opening ceremony took place in the main auditorium and featured the participation of prominent legal experts and academics. During the ceremony, the relevance of ensuring the rule of law as a fundamental basis for the functioning of a fair and equitable society was emphasized.

In the words of one of the speakers at the congress: "It is the responsibility of all, especially new generations, to safeguard the defense of democratic principles and the rule of law. It is they who hold the future of our institutions and the consolidation of a society based on respect for laws and the fundamental rights of citizens in their hands."

The congress serves as a space for reflection and debate in which relevant legal issues at a global level will be addressed, with the aim of promoting a constructive dialogue on the current challenges facing the rule of law in different international contexts. The importance of involving new generations in this discussion is highlighted as a key element to ensure the relevance and legitimacy of democratic institutions in the future.
